Suspensions and colloids are two common types of mixtures whose properties are in many ways intermediate between those of homogeneous and heterogeneous mixtures. A suspension is a mixture of particles with diameters of about 1 µm (1000 nm) that are distributed throughout a second phase. Common suspensions include paint, blood, and hot.

A hot chocolate wouldn't be a hot chocolate without cocoa powder. Mixing this in with your milk forms a colloid - a mixture in which solid particles are suspended within a fluid. However, be wary when mixing cocoa powder into milk - the surface tension of milk makes it difficult for the cocoa powder to penetrate it, which you may have.

1 pinch ground cinnamon. Instructions: Heat milk in a saucepan over medium heat for 3 to 4 minutes. Add brown sugar and stir until dissolved. Stir dark chocolate until it's completely melted. About 2 to 3 minutes.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the cream and cinnamon.
